Insider Selling: IDT (NYSE:IDT) CFO Sells $47,876.80 in Stock

Key Points

  • CFO Marcelo Fischer sold 7,009 shares on Jan. 14 at an average of $52.03 (≈$364,678) and additional small lots on Jan. 15 and Jan. 8, cutting his stake by roughly 11% per SEC filings — a notable insider sell-off.
  • CEO Tebogo Malaka resigned amid allegations tied to a bribery sting related to an R836 million oxygen‑plant project, creating short‑term governance and reputational risk for the company.
  • IDT recently beat quarterly estimates with $0.94 EPS vs. $0.88 consensus and $322.75M revenue vs. $308M est.; the company has a $1.26B market cap, a 15.55 PE ratio, and pays a $0.06 quarterly dividend (≈0.5% yield).

IDT Corporation (NYSE:IDT - Get Free Report) CFO Marcelo Fischer sold 920 shares of the firm's stock in a transaction that occurred on Thursday, January 15th. The shares were sold at an average price of $52.04, for a total value of $47,876.80. Following the completion of the sale, the chief financial officer directly owned 55,943 shares in the company, valued at approximately $2,911,273.72. The trade was a 1.62% decrease in their ownership of the stock. The sale was disclosed in a document filed with the SEC, which is available through this link.

Marcelo Fischer also recently made the following trade(s):

  • On Wednesday, January 14th, Marcelo Fischer sold 7,009 shares of IDT stock. The stock was sold at an average price of $52.03, for a total value of $364,678.27.
  • On Thursday, January 8th, Marcelo Fischer sold 641 shares of IDT stock. The shares were sold at an average price of $52.29, for a total value of $33,517.89.

IDT Stock Performance

IDT stock opened at $50.08 on Friday. The stock has a market capitalization of $1.26 billion, a P/E ratio of 15.55 and a beta of 0.78. The company's fifty day moving average price is $50.85 and its 200 day moving average price is $55.88. IDT Corporation has a 1 year low of $45.07 and a 1 year high of $71.12.




IDT (NYSE:IDT - Get Free Report) last posted its quarterly earnings data on Thursday, December 4th. The utilities provider reported $0.94 earnings per share (EPS) for the quarter, beating the consensus estimate of $0.88 by $0.06. IDT had a net margin of 6.53% and a return on equity of 27.12%. The business had revenue of $322.75 million for the quarter, compared to the consensus estimate of $308.00 million.

IDT Announces Dividend

The business also recently declared a quarterly dividend, which was paid on Tuesday, December 23rd. Investors of record on Monday, December 15th were paid a $0.06 dividend. The ex-dividend date of this dividend was Monday, December 15th. This represents a $0.24 dividend on an annualized basis and a yield of 0.5%. IDT's dividend payout ratio (DPR) is currently 7.45%.

Institutional Inflows and Outflows

A number of institutional investors have recently bought and sold shares of the business. SG Americas Securities LLC purchased a new stake in shares of IDT in the fourth quarter valued at approximately $748,000. Public Employees Retirement System of Ohio acquired a new position in IDT during the third quarter worth $96,000. Ameriprise Financial Inc. acquired a new position in IDT during the third quarter worth $399,000. California State Teachers Retirement System grew its holdings in IDT by 27.0% in the 3rd quarter. California State Teachers Retirement System now owns 19,481 shares of the utilities provider's stock valued at $1,019,000 after buying an additional 4,136 shares in the last quarter. Finally, Strs Ohio increased its stake in shares of IDT by 5.9% in the 3rd quarter. Strs Ohio now owns 10,700 shares of the utilities provider's stock worth $560,000 after acquiring an additional 600 shares during the last quarter. 59.34% of the stock is owned by hedge funds and other institutional investors.

Wall Street Analysts Forecast Growth

IDT has been the subject of a number of research analyst reports. Weiss Ratings reissued a "hold (c+)" rating on shares of IDT in a report on Monday, December 29th. Wall Street Zen raised IDT from a "buy" rating to a "strong-buy" rating in a research note on Saturday, December 13th. One analyst has rated the stock with a Hold rating, Based on data from MarketBeat, IDT has an average rating of "Hold".

Get Our Latest Stock Report on IDT

Key Headlines Impacting IDT

Here are the key news stories impacting IDT this week:

  • Neutral Sentiment: One linked press item references Integrated DNA Technologies (a different "IDT") expanding its product portfolio; this appears unrelated to NYSE:IDT but could cause occasional headline confusion. Integrated DNA Technologies Expands Synthetic Biology Portfolio
  • Negative Sentiment: CEO Tebogo Malaka resigned amid allegations tied to a bribery sting and pending disciplinary action; coverage cites fallout from a R836 million oxygen-plant project and notes public officials welcoming the resignation. A CEO departure under investigation raises short-term operational and reputational risk and increases governance uncertainty for investors. Suspended IDT CEO Tebogo Malaka resigns following bribery scandal
  • Negative Sentiment: Chief Financial Officer Marcelo Fischer executed two recent stock sales (7,009 shares on Jan 14 at ~$52.03 and 920 shares on Jan 15 at ~$52.04). Combined, these filings show a meaningful reduction in his direct holding (reported up to ~10.97% decrease then a further ~1.62% decrease), which markets often interpret as a negative signal on near-term insider conviction despite his remaining sizable stake. The SEC filing with the transaction details is available here: SEC ownership filing

IDT Company Profile

(Get Free Report)

IDT Corporation, founded in 1990 and headquartered in Newark, New Jersey, is a diversified global provider of telecommunications and payment services. The company operates through its primary communications arm, IDT Telecom, and a digital solutions segment that encompasses cross-border money transfers and related fintech offerings. Since its inception, IDT has built an international network infrastructure to support voice and data transmission across more than 200 countries and territories.

Through IDT Telecom, the company offers a suite of voice communication products, including prepaid phone cards, VoIP services, SIP trunking and operator-assisted calling.

Read More

This instant news alert was generated by narrative science technology and financial data from InsiderTrades.com in order to provide readers with the fastest and most accurate reporting. Please send any questions or comments about this story to [email protected].

Insider Buying or Selling at IDT?
Sign-up to receive InsiderTrades.com's daily insider buying and selling report for IDT and related companies.
From Our Partners
Free Insider Buying and Selling Newsletter
Enter your email address below to receive InsiderTrades.com's daily insider buying and selling report.
From Our Partners

Most Read This Month

Recent Articles